Cui Yu Mamian Skirt: Exquisite Fusion of Ming Dynasty Crown and Queen Mother of the West Mythology

The "Cui Yu" Mamian Skirt draws inspiration from Empress Xiaojing's magnificent "Three Dragons and Two Phoenixes Crown" of the Ming Dynasty.
